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
04 58565253564 48292672894
73 1212241
73 1212241
53077485119 097 77276584
All about undefined
Interested in learning more?
73 1212241
53077485119 097 77276584
See more
112804 05 20
78175704152 158 21842157
See more
015 0903245
498465 36 692312
See more